Addressing the Kongres Negara 2020, Muhyiddin said a proposal to form a new party chapter will be drafted. If it is accepted, an extraordinary general meeting will be called to amend the party constitution.
Presently, PPBM allows non-Malays to join the party as associate members but they cannot hold leadership positions.
Muhyiddin said a special task force to work on the proposed amendments will be formed and led by supreme council member Rais Yatim.
“At a recent meeting of the PPBM supreme council, I suggested the possibility of allowing associate members to contribute ideas not just as normal members, but with a role in leadership, to shape a new chapter in PPBM.
“We have decided to form a new chapter that will allow associate members to hold positions and contribute ideas to advance the party.”
